The entertainment industry is witnessing a significant shift as Thruline Entertainment welcomes two dynamic professionals to its team. Abby Johnson and Kimberly Kottwitz, previously colleagues at Brave Artists Management, have joined forces under the Thruline banner. Together, they bring a wealth of experience and a fresh perspective on talent management. The duo has already begun to make an impact by bringing along several promising artists who are set to shine in the coming years.
A diverse array of young talents will benefit from the expertise of Johnson and Kottwitz. Among these emerging stars are performers like Joshua Colley, known for his role in "Descendants: The Rise of Red," and Abi Monterey from "Doom Patrol." Other notable additions include Oona O’Brien from "Cobra Kai," Hero Hunter from "Lessons in Chemistry" and "Young Dylan," Madison Shamoun from "Z Suite," and Ali Fumiko Whitney from "Find Me Falling."
